Peter Burgess (Truro, NS) finished 4-3 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Burgess lost 6-3 to Jamie Murphy (Halifax, NS), droppimg another game, 10-9 to Ian Juurlink (Halifax, NS) where Burgess responded with a 8-3 win over Chad Stevens (Halifax, NS). Burgess went on to lose 7-2 against Paul Flemming (Halifax, NS). Burgess responded with a 6-4 win over Mark Dacey (Halifax, NS). Burgess won 7-5 against Alan O'Leary (Halifax, NS), then won 5-3 against Shea Steele (Halifax, NS) in their final qualifying round match.
. For week 26 of the event schedule, Burgess did not improve upon their best events, dropping from 295th to 300th place overall on the World Ranking Standings with 1.250 total points. Burgess ranks 239th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 1.250 points earned so far this season.
